What are the functions of hibiscus flowers

February 22, 2021

Functions

Both hibiscus flower and leaves can be used as medicine. The hibiscus flower has the effects of clearing heat and cooling blood, reducing swelling and draining pus. It is suitable for fever, sore carbuncle, breast carbuncle, lung heat cough, pulmonary carbuncle and other diseases. It can also be used for uterine bleeding caused by blood heat, and it is often used with lotus shell. The function of hibiscus leaf is similar to that of flower. Generally, it is used for external application. It can reduce swelling and relieve pain. It is suitable for heat boils, boils, carbuncle, water and fire burns, and lumps caused by injections in the buttocks.

General dosage

Hibiscus flower 9-15 grams, 30 grams can be used in large doses, decoction. Apply appropriate amount of hibiscus leaves externally, wash the fresh leaves, mash them for external application, grind the dried leaves into fine pieces, called'Yulusan', mix them into a paste with honey water or sesame oil, apply to the affected area, and change the dressing every 24 hours. A cool feeling after application is a good sign.
